I'm looking for information on the following individual: REVEREND RICHARD WRIGHT Birth: 15 Jun 1783 in <http://places.ancestry.com/index.aspx?tid=11540201&pid=-266459676&eid=64326 12912> Randolph County, North Carolina Death: Nov 1843 in <http://places.ancestry.com/index.aspx?tid=11540201&pid=-266459676&eid=64326 12911> Greene County, Indiana Son of Benjamin Wright, Sr. [b. abt 1752; d. abt 1842] and Barbara Morgan. Married: <http://trees.ancestry.com/tree/11540201/person/-137627121> ELIZABETH HUGHES 1783 - 1830 According to the 1830 census, they had 11 children. I'm looking for bona fide information on the children's names. I recently received from the Greene County Clerk's Office 3 partial pages of "Petition to sell lands" that appear to be a later part of Reverend Wright's estate - but after the fact of what should have been the original estate/Probate document. Specifically named in these three documents are named 3 daughters - SARAH HOKE, MARTHA WILKS, AND POLLY WRIGHT; and one son, JEREMIAH WRIGHT. Other than these, no other children's names were mentioned in the document. To date, with the exception of JAMES [a renowned preacher], SARAH, MARTHA, POLLY AND JEREMIAH, I've not been able to find anything to indicate other children by birth or name - such as Bible or estate documents. The dates of birth indicated by many researchers do not appear to match up with the years as indicated in the two censuses. I know that censuses can be misleading by at least several years. Year of birth and the dates of the censuses will make for that allowance: I'm willing to accept information that may vary to that extent. Second marriage: Judith Walker on May 22, 1834 in Greene Co., IN. No children from this marriage. Shirley
